Empowering Writers’ training and resources align with the new Alberta outcomes for grades K-3.
WHAT YOU WILL LEARN:
Instructional tools to support deeper comprehension of text, apply analysis skills to constructed response, confidently teach narrative writing, and learn how to provide actionable feedback when assessing student work. Gain understanding of foundational writing skills to help students effectively respond to text and strengthen both writing abilities and reading comprehension skills.
HOW THE TRAINING BREAKS OUT:
Session 1, October 11, 2022 – Launching into Literacy
- Understanding EW’s Methodology and How it Creates Writing Success
- Recognizing Genre
- Identifying Organizational Frameworks (e.g., Informational vs. Narrative)
- Learning How to Annotate and Analyze Text
- Finding Literary Elements for Literary Analysis
- Identifying Text Conventions (clues) for Constructed Response
Session 2, October 18, 2022 – Narrative Skills
- Developing an Entertaining Beginning
- Creating Elaborate Details
- Building Suspense
- Describing the Main Event
- Developing Extended Endings
Session 3, October 25, 2022 – Putting It All Together
- Practicing Process Writing
- Forming Assessment Rubrics
- Recap of Today’s Learning – Narrative Writing
